Understanding Deck Installation Costs
What Are the Average Deck Installation Costs?
Before diving into specifics, let’s take a look at what homeowners can expect when budgeting for deck installation. On average, deck installation costs can range vastly depending on several factors including size, materials used, and whether you choose to hire a professional or take on the project yourself.
| Deck Material | Cost per Square Foot | |--------------------|---------------------------| | Pressure-treated wood | $15 - $30 | | Composite decking | $20 - $50 | | PVC decking | $25 - $60 | | Hardwood | $30 - $70 |
As you can see from the table above, material choice is one of the biggest determinants in overall cost.

Labor Costs: What You Need to Know
Labor fees can vary significantly based on the experience of the contractor and your geographical location. Typically, labor costs for deck installation range from $10 to $30 per square foot depending on complexity and skill level.

Pressure-Treated Wood
A popular choice due to its affordability and durability against insects and rot.
Composite Materials
These materials offer low maintenance requirements but come at a higher initial investment.
PVC (Polyvinyl Chloride) Decking
Highly resistant to moisture and fading; however, it comes with a premium price tag.
Hardwoods
Exotic woods bring unparalleled beauty but require regular maintenance.

When budgeting for deck installation, consider hidden costs that may arise:
- Site preparation (removal of old structures). Additional features like lighting or built-in seating. Landscaping changes post-installation.
Planning ahead ensures you're not caught off guard by unexpected expenses!
